First Cross Arm Erected in Kanpur Metro's Baradevi-Naubasta Elevated Section

Kanpur, India (Metro Rail Today): Under the ambitious Corridor-1 (IIT-Naubasta) of the Kanpur Metro Rail Project, a significant step forward has been taken with the initiation of the erection of the first Cross Arm along the 5.5 km long Baradevi-Naubasta Elevated section. This marks a crucial milestone on the 10th of November, 2023.

The first Cross Arm, erected at the under-construction Naubasta Metro Station, will play a pivotal role in extending the length of metro stations. Currently set at 80 meters, this expansion strategy is envisioned to accommodate the rising number of passengers. Plans include extending the station length up to 140 meters.

In the Baradevi-Naubasta section, a total of four Cross Arms are slated for placement at each metro station. Baradevi, in particular, will feature two Cross Arms on both sides. The Kanpur Central-Transport Nagar underground section of Baradevi station is set to have one Cross Arm, with the remaining three on the opposite side. This strategic distribution totals to 20 Cross Arms within this section.

Highlighting its versatility, the 'Cross Arm' is designed to act as a substitute for pier caps. Prefabricated in the casting yard alongside pier caps and girders, these Cross Arms are then lifted into place with the aid of cranes on the elevated structure of the metro.

Metro engineers have made provisions to extend the length of stations by approximately 60 meters, allowing for an extension from 80 meters to 140 meters. This foresight ensures the potential operation of six-coach metro trains, a significant upgrade from the existing four-coach capacity.

The construction journey of the Baradevi-Naubasta elevated section, initiated on August 8, 2022, has seen noteworthy milestones. These include the laying of the first pier cap on December 27, 2022, and the erection of the first U-girder on January 21, 2023. The recent commencement of Pi-girder installation at the Baradevi and Kidwai Nagar stations signifies ongoing progress.

Sushil Kumar, Managing Director of Uttar Pradesh Metro Rail Corporation Ltd. (UPMRC), commended the Kanpur metro engineers on their commendable progress in civil construction. Following the successful initiation of metro services from IIT to Motijheel, the focus is now on meeting deadlines for the remaining section of the first corridor (Chunniganj-Naubasta).

Currently, construction activities are progressing rapidly not only on the Baradevi-Naubasta elevated section but also on the Kanpur Central-Transport Nagar underground section and the Chunniganj-Nayaganj underground section. This reaffirms the commitment to the timely completion of the Kanpur Metro Rail Project.
